This VMI rectangular range hood liner is the metal housing that fits inside a 36-inch wood mantel hood shell and accepts a compatible Air-Pro ventilator. It bridges the decorative enclosure and the air-moving unit, finished in black to recede inside the hood opening.
A wood mantel hood is built in three parts: the decorative wood shell, the liner, and the ventilator. The shell provides the look. The ventilator moves the air. This liner is the structural middle piece that ties them together. It sits inside the shell and provides the correct housing geometry so the Air-Pro ventilator mounts securely and seats flush. Without the right liner, the ventilator has nothing to locate into, and the shell has no internal structure to work against.
Inside a painted or dark-stained mantel hood, a black-finish liner disappears into the opening rather than contrasting with the surrounding woodwork. That matters when the hood valance is open to view from across the room and the interior should read as a shadow rather than an exposed metal panel. The Air-Pro 011, 01A, 021, 02A, and 04 models are confirmed compatible. Specify the liner alongside one of these ventilators to ensure the unit seats correctly inside the shell.
Black works best when the hood interior is dark, the surrounding cabinetry is a deep finish, or you want the liner to recede visually. For lighter interiors or where a bright metallic contrast is acceptable, the silver metallic and stainless options in this series are the alternative.
The liner is 34-7/16 inches wide, 19-1/2 inches deep, and 4 inches tall, with an 11-13/16 by 17-1/2 inch hole for the ventilator. These are the fit-critical numbers to check against the shell and the ventilator before ordering.
